As a systems analyst, it was necessary to develop and describe various types of documents, including:

  • Technical specifications (TS): detailed description of system requirements, functionality, and constraints.
  • Business requirements: description of the goals and objectives of the business that the system should address.
  • UML diagrams: class diagrams, sequence diagrams, use case diagrams for visualizing architecture and processes.
  • Interface specifications: description of APIs, data formats, and interaction protocols.
  • User scenarios and cases: description of steps for system usage by end-users.
  • Analysis and risk assessment reports: identifying potential problems and ways to minimize them.

Such documentation helps to align understanding among clients, developers, and other project participants.
